Title: Cochiti Green Chile Stew
Yield: 6 Servings

Ingredients

      2 lb lean chuck; cut in small
           -cubes
      2 tb oil
    1/2 md onion; chopped
      4 md potatoes; peeled and diced
      4 md zucchini squash; chopped
     12 lg green chiles; roasted and
           -peeled
      1 ts garlic salt
      1 ts salt
      1 c  water

Instructions

Brown the chuck in a little oil in a large deep pan. Add the onions, saute
3-5 minutes. Add the potatoes. When the ingredients have browned pour off
any oil. Add the zucchini, if used, the chiles cut up, garlic salt, salt
and water. Bring to a boil and simmer for at least 1/2 hour. Stew should be
eaten with a spoon like a hearty sooup.
